This is called a “restricted donation” since the charity is restricted in what we can do with the money.
We can accept restricted donations, that we can only use to buy Goit Stock Wood, on the following basis:
You need to let us know that you want your donation to be a restricted donation by making that clear at the time you make the donation. That means using this donation form if you are donating as an individual or this form if you are donating on behalf of a business (or other organisation) - or stating this clearly in a covering letter if you send us a cheque. We'll keep a record of your name, contact details and donation amount.
If you make a restricted donation and we can't buy Goit Stock Wood, we'll contact you to offer you a refund of your donation. If you would like a refund, you'll need to give us your bank details (must be a UK account) so we can pay the money back to you.
We can only accept restricted donations of £60 or more. This is because we are a run by a small team of volunteers and we won't have the capacity to contact lots of donors of smaller amounts in order to offer refunds.
If you make a donation by credit/debit card, we will incur processing fees which we can't get back. So if we can't buy the wood and you ask for a refund of a donation made by card we'll deduct 2.5% from the amount we refund to you to cover this cost. If you want to avoid this happening, please make your payment by bank transfer instead.
If you would like to donate under £60, please consider making an unrestricted donation instead.
